Senior Environmental Health Safety Specialist
We are Generac, a leading energy technology company committed to powering a smarter world. The Environmental Health and Safety (EHS) Specialist III is responsible for the support of day-to-day environmental, health and safety functions at multiple sites. This position supports the facility EHS program to maintain a safe and healthy work environment, monitoring the facility and processes for adherence to OSHA, EPA, Wisconsin DNR, DOT, and other local regulations and guidelines. Additionally, this role is responsible for conducting environmental monitoring and reporting, providing assistance with environmental permit applications, and assisting with internal EHS audits. This position works closely with cross-functional teams throughout the facility and leads the pursuit of zero incidents.
